Pfizer ships vaccines via FedEX and UPS

-

New York, USA (CWBN)_ Pfizer has shipped over 500,000 doses of its vaccine from its manufacturing plant in Kalamazoo, Michigan, via the United States Parcel Service and FedEx, to central distribution centres, and 145 departments and hospitals, a spokesperson for the company announced earlier today.

However, transporting the vaccine has proved tricky given the requirement for keeping it at minus 70.5 degrees Celsius (-95 degrees Fahrenheit).

It is expected that healthcare workers and care-home residents will be among the first to receive the jab once the immunization campaign begins over the next two days. The general populace would have to await their turn as the company continues to grind out doses.

Pfizer has pledged to provide about 25 million doses to the US within the month, starting with a batch of 2.9 million doses in the next seven days. Given that immunization requires 2 doses per person, it is expected that about 1.45 million people will be will receive their shots.

On the 12th of December, Chief Operating Officer for the Operation Warp Speed vaccination campaign, General Gustave Perna said that doses will initially cover about 636 sites across the US today (14th Dec), while another 425 sites will receive their supplies by tomorrow, and another 66 sites by Wednesday.
